摘要
通过除冰盐对寒区混凝土的早期破坏机理及影响因素的探讨,提出了防治混凝土早期破坏的技术措施。掺入引气剂和降低水灰比是提高混凝土抗盐冻剥蚀的最有效方法;磨细矿渣能够抑制除冰盐引起的碱骨料反应;合理设置排水系统、密实混凝土和提高保护层厚度是保护钢筋的有效措施。
The paper present the techno-measure of resisting early deterioration of concrete, resorting to the discussion on early detrioration mechanism and influencing factors of the deicing salt on concrete in cold region. Mixing air entraining agents and reducing water cement ratio were the most effective solution to improve resistance deicing salt scaling of concrete. Blast furnace slag can suppress alkali aggreate reaction caused by deicing salt. Setting up a rational drainage system, compacting concrete and improving concrete cover thickness were effective measures to protect bars.
